Major Ada County, Idaho Real Estate Markets

Boise anchors Ada County's real estate activity as the state capital and largest metropolitan area, featuring everything from historic North End craftsman homes to modern downtown condominiums. The city's tech sector growth has created significant demand in neighborhoods like the Foothills, where luxury properties command premium prices, while areas like Southeast Boise offer more accessible entry points for first-time buyers.

Beyond Boise, communities like Meridian have emerged as major growth centers, with new construction dominating the landscape and family-friendly subdivisions attracting relocating professionals. Eagle maintains its position as the county's premium market, offering equestrian properties and custom homes, while Star and Kuna provide more rural residential options that appeal to buyers seeking larger lots and agricultural lifestyle opportunities.

Market Dynamics and Geographic Complexity

Ada County's real estate market operates with surprising complexity despite its relatively compact geographic footprint, featuring distinct micro-markets that can vary dramatically in pricing and inventory levels. The county experiences seasonal fluctuations typical of Mountain West markets, with spring and summer driving peak activity, though year-round migration from California and Washington has created more consistent demand patterns than historically observed.

Inventory constraints remain a defining characteristic, with new construction struggling to keep pace with population growth, creating competitive bidding situations even in slower market periods. The market also demonstrates unusual resilience to economic fluctuations, supported by diverse employment sectors including technology, healthcare, government, and agriculture, which provide stability across different economic cycles.
